Active Learning : A Powerful Methodology for Kindergarten

In kindergarten, children are like little sponges, devouring new information and skills. Play-Based Learning is a fantastic way to help them grow in a fun and interactive environment.

Through play, children discover important concepts such as problem-solving. They also build social abilities while having a blast!

Play-Based Learning encourages a safe space for children to take risks without the fear of failure. This builds their confidence to step outside their comfort zone.

  • For example: Building a tower with blocks helps spatial reasoning and problem-solving skills.
  • Similarly: Pretend play enhances social skills, language development, and imagination.

By embracing Play-Based Learning, kindergarten teachers can create a dynamic classroom where children are motivated to learn.
